This is my first time seeing this collage and first off. WOW. I like the choice and placement of each image and think they work marvelously together without any further poking or proding. To my eye, it seems the top two photos are sitting just slightly to the right of the four below. A thick black line in PS on a seperate layer above would really nail it. I agree that the border may be just a bit heavy.
Just to add my two cents, I'd say the inner border should be the same width as the lines between each image and that the outter border should be the same. Seperating the two I would suggest a thinner yellow line.

I like this new border better than the original, but you might want to experiment with a thinner border, and one that is perhaps a little less yellow and a little more orange. The placement of each photograph is right on the money and pleasing to the eye, though I wonder if flipping the upper left image horizontally would anchor the entire montage diagonally by placing sunflower "cores" in each corner.
